Review summary

Created with AI, based on recent reviews

Considering 134 reviews, most reviewers were let down by their experience overall, with many expressing strong dissatisfaction with the platform. Customers frequently report issues with account blocking and arbitrary bans, often without clear reasons or prior warnings, even for seemingly innocuous content. Many also found the moderation to be inconsistent and biased, with some users experiencing censorship while others engaged in hate speech or harassment without consequence. Reviewers often describe the website as declining, citing a proliferation of fake profiles, scammers, and a lack of genuine engagement, leading to a perception of it being a 'dying site'. Furthermore, some people mentioned difficulties with deleting accounts and a general lack of accountability from the platform regarding user concerns and reports of inappropriate content.

I've been placed on Edit-Ban 2 times in…

I've been placed on Edit-Ban 2 times in the last month which resulted in 2 weeks of being blocked from posting or responding. Given that the platform has very few Human Moderators that actually read comments when they are flagged it has been hijacked by people who just don't like what someone else posts. The greater majority of Quora is moderated by AI. In my case someone just flags my post as plagiarism and the edit ban is instant. There aren't eyes on to actually read the post to see that sources are in the comment. This is an abuse of the platform rules but those that engage in this behavior never experience consequences. Quora has lost a lot of really good commenters that made the site enjoyable to use. It's going to go the way of twitter & Facebook. People are just staying away because Quora s' traffic has declined and declining traffic means less revenue. Ads are not going to be bought on Quora if there are not people responding to them. They need to fix this.
